    Stop Living on Autopilot: Rewire Your Life (Erin Coupe) - Episode 221

    You can look successful on the outside—and still feel like something is missing. Meet Erin Coupe, founder of Authentically EC, former Wall Street executive, international speaker, and author of I Can Fit That In: How Rituals Transform Your Life. On the outside, Erin had the life many people dream of—career success, a loving family, and constant professional recognition. But just before her 36th birthday, she found herself asking a question that many high achievers quietly carry inside: “How can this be it?” That moment sparked a powerful awakening that led Erin to discover a transformative concept: the difference between routines and rituals. Instead of piling more productivity hacks onto an already overwhelming schedule, Erin began shifting from rigid routines to intentional rituals—small, meaningful practices that reconnect you with your energy, purpose, and authentic self. In this conversation, we explore how rituals can rewire your brain, support emotional and mental well-being, and help high-performing professionals move from burnout and autopilot to clarity and fulfillment. If you’ve ever felt successful on the outside but disconnected on the inside, this episode will give you practical tools to design a life that actually fuels you. In This Episode We Cover The difference between routines vs rituals (and why it matters)Why high achievers often feel burned out or disconnectedHow rituals can rewire your brain using neuroscienceSimple daily rituals that improve energy, focus, and well-beingThe role of authenticity in creating a fulfilling lifeHow to shift from autopilot living to intentional livingPractical ways to transform your day without adding more to your scheduleAbout Erin Coupe Erin Coupe is the founder of Authentically EC, an international speaker, leadership advisor, and author of I Can Fit That In: How Rituals Transform Your Life. After a successful career on Wall Street, Erin began exploring the intersection of neuroscience, spirituality, and leadership to help people break free from burnout and design lives rooted in authenticity and purpose.     The Hidden Trauma We All Carry (And How to Heal It) (Diana Bitting) - Episode 217

    Today’s conversation is one that touches every single one of us — whether we realize it or not. We’re talking about trauma. Not just the big, obvious trauma. Not just what happened to you. But how it lives inside your body… and quietly shapes your health, stress levels, relationships, and even your sense of purpose. Joining us is Diana Bitting, co-founder and CEO of Catbird Health, an AI-powered trauma-informed care platform pioneering an entirely new model for healing. But Diana didn’t start here. She spent decades struggling with a chronic inflammatory condition that no doctor could explain. Test after test came back “normal.” She was told it was stress. Or anxiety. Or maybe even “all in her head.” Sound familiar? After trying everything — diets, protocols, medications, functional medicine, and talk therapy — nothing created lasting relief. Until one conversation changed everything. When Diana began exploring trauma science and nervous system healing, her symptoms started to lift. Because here’s what she discovered: Trauma doesn’t just live in the brain. It lives in the body. And until the nervous system feels safe, true healing can’t happen. In this episode, we explore: Why trauma is stored in the nervous systemThe link between inflammation, anxiety, insomnia, and unresolved traumaWhy talk therapy alone may not be enoughThe difference between cognitive healing and body-based healingHow personalized, trauma-informed care is changing the future of medicineWhy every single one of us can benefit from trauma healingThis conversation is grounded in science, but it’s also deeply hopeful. Because healing trauma isn’t just about resolving the past. It’s about unlocking energy, clarity, connection, and purpose in the present. If you’ve ever felt like something was “off” in your body — even when everything looked fine on paper — this episode may connect some powerful dots. You are not broken. Your body has been protecting you. And healing is possible.
